Comprehensive Overview of Mazda Connected Services
Mazda Connected Services encompass a wide range of features that collectively work to provide a connected, informed, and secure driving experience. These features are accessible through Mazda’s dedicated smartphone app and in-vehicle infotainment system, enabling owners to stay engaged with their vehicle anytime and anywhere. Below is a detailed breakdown of the primary components of Mazda Connected Services:
- Remote Vehicle Monitoring: This feature allows owners to monitor key vehicle parameters such as fuel level, battery status, door lock status, and even vehicle location from their smartphone. In addition, drivers can remotely lock or unlock doors, a valuable function for both convenience and security. This remote access reduces the risk of vehicle theft and unauthorized usage, providing peace of mind and potentially lowering insurance costs.
- Proactive Maintenance Alerts: Keeping a vehicle in top condition is critical to avoiding expensive repairs. Mazda Connected Services sends timely notifications for routine maintenance tasks such as oil changes, tire rotations, brake inspections, and filter replacements. These alerts are based on real-time vehicle data and driving conditions, ensuring services are performed exactly when needed. This proactive approach helps maintain the vehicle’s reliability and resale value while preventing deterioration that could lead to costly repairs.
- Advanced Navigation and Traffic Updates: Real-time navigation assistance provides drivers with up-to-date traffic information, route optimization, and alternative path suggestions. By helping drivers avoid traffic congestion, road closures, and accidents, Mazda Connected Services contribute to more efficient driving routes, reducing travel time and fuel consumption. This not only saves money on fuel but also reduces vehicle wear from stop-and-go traffic and idling.
- Emergency and Roadside Assistance: In the event of a breakdown, accident, or other emergency, Mazda Connected Services provide quick access to roadside assistance and emergency response services. The system can automatically send your vehicle’s location to emergency responders, helping reduce response times and ensuring driver safety. Having this service built into the vehicle reduces the need for costly third-party emergency plans and limits out-of-pocket expenses during unexpected situations.
- Vehicle Health Reports: Periodic detailed health reports provide insights into the overall condition of the vehicle, highlighting any potential issues detected by onboard diagnostics. These reports help owners better understand their vehicle’s status and prioritize necessary repairs or maintenance, avoiding the escalation of minor problems into major failures.
- Driving Behavior Analytics: Some Mazda Connected Services include monitoring of driving habits such as acceleration, braking, and cornering. By providing feedback on efficient driving techniques, these features encourage behaviors that can extend vehicle life and improve fuel economy, indirectly reducing ownership costs.
Impact on Cost of Ownership
The integration of connected technology into Mazda vehicles significantly influences the financial aspects of ownership. Below, we explore specific ways these services help reduce expenses and add value over time.
1. Preventing Costly Repairs Through Timely Maintenance
One of the largest contributors to vehicle ownership costs is unexpected repairs, often stemming from delayed or neglected maintenance. Mazda Connected Services address this issue by providing accurate, timely alerts for all necessary services based on actual vehicle usage and conditions. For example, rather than relying on generic mileage thresholds, the system considers driving style, weather, and terrain to tailor maintenance recommendations.
This targeted approach ensures that components such as the engine oil, brake pads, and tires are serviced or replaced before they fail. Preventative maintenance avoids expensive repairs caused by damage to other systems — such as engine damage from old oil or suspension problems from worn tires. Over the lifespan of a Mazda vehicle, owners who use these services can expect to save hundreds or even thousands of dollars in service costs.
2. Enhancing Fuel Efficiency with Real-Time Navigation
Fuel is a continuous expense for vehicle owners, and inefficient driving or routing can quickly add up. Mazda’s connected navigation system provides dynamic routing based on live traffic data, construction updates, and accident reports. By avoiding traffic jams and stop-and-go conditions, drivers can reduce idle time and maintain steady speeds, both factors that contribute to better fuel economy.
Additionally, Mazda Connected Services may suggest routes that optimize fuel efficiency rather than simply minimizing distance or time. Over weeks and months, these improvements in driving efficiency can translate into significant savings at the pump and reduce the vehicle’s environmental footprint.
3. Improved Security and Theft Prevention
Vehicle theft and vandalism can result in substantial replacement and repair costs, not to mention the inconvenience and stress caused. Mazda’s remote vehicle monitoring and alert system enhance security by notifying owners immediately if unauthorized access is detected. Furthermore, the ability to remotely lock or unlock the vehicle adds an extra layer of protection.
In many cases, insurance companies recognize the reduced risk associated with vehicles equipped with advanced security features and connected monitoring. This can lead to lower insurance premiums, directly reducing the ongoing cost of ownership.
4. Minimizing Downtime and Emergency Expenses
Breakdowns and accidents are unpredictable but can be financially draining. Mazda Connected Services’ emergency assistance feature ensures swift access to help, minimizing vehicle downtime and the potential for more severe damage or injury. Prompt roadside assistance can prevent situations from escalating, such as a minor battery issue turning into a tow and extended repair.
This proactive safety net reduces out-of-pocket costs and can also lower the likelihood of needing costly emergency repairs by addressing problems before they worsen.
5. Increasing Resale Value Through Transparent Vehicle History
Vehicles equipped with Mazda Connected Services maintain a comprehensive and accurate log of maintenance history and vehicle health status. When it comes time to sell or trade in the vehicle, this transparent record serves as proof of diligent care and timely servicing, increasing buyer confidence and potentially raising resale value.
Higher resale or trade-in values offset the initial purchase and ownership costs, contributing to a better overall financial outcome for Mazda owners.

How to Get Started with Mazda Connected Services
To take advantage of Mazda Connected Services, owners should first ensure their vehicle is equipped with the necessary hardware and software packages, which are typically available on most newer Mazda models. Registration and setup are straightforward:
- Download the Mazda App: Available on both iOS and Android platforms, the app serves as the central hub for all connected features.
- Create or Link Your Account: Existing Mazda owners can link their vehicle’s VIN to their account to enable vehicle-specific services.
- Activate Connected Services: Follow the in-app instructions to activate features such as remote monitoring, maintenance alerts, and navigation updates.
- Customize Notifications: Tailor alerts and preferences to match your lifestyle and driving habits.
Regularly updating the app and vehicle software ensures you have access to the latest features and improvements.
